Output d081d5c1d5b3af508622f49baab6ef3a366d2111d5e6060635215ad59cb693c9:12

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c710229787c61f5e697c5b10942dd14251bff2 OP_EQUAL
address
3KSuUuBZ1TJHY4UspfwhnE1cWzSJc5rAcd
transaction
d081d5c1d5b3af508622f49baab6ef3a366d2111d5e6060635215ad59cb693c9
confirmations
254698
spent
true